Handover for the Pipewren webhook service. Delivery retries use exponential backoff: five attempts over roughly 30 minutes, then the event moves to the dead-letter queue. Note that 410 responses disable the endpoint immediately — no retries — which has surprised partners before. The retry scheduler config ships with the release bundle, so any cadence change needs your sign-off. Full retry semantics, including the jitter formula and DLQ replay steps, are written up here:

runbook for badug-kadup: https://confluence.zemvarlabs.internal/projects/browse/display/projects/bd1b

Subject: Handover — Larkspur catalogue import

Hi all,

Welcome aboard. The monthly import pulls the Bellwright library catalogue into Larkspur's staging index. Run the dry-run first; mismatched shelf codes are the usual failure and can be fixed with the remap script in tools. Once counts reconcile, promote to production and notify the cataloguing team. The import job must be signed before the scheduler will accept it, so attach the signature generated with the key below.

Thanks, and good luck.

rollout seal: bky4_x7Gc

## Releases

SlimCrate images ship weekly. v0.14 cut the base image from 412MB to 96MB: dropped build toolchain, switched to the Hollowpine minimal base, multi-stage build only. Eng sync note: no further slimming planned this quarter; focus shifts to scan times. All published images are signed at push. Verify pulls against the current registry signing key, listed below.

signing key of bagap-yawep = bky13_TbfT6ZMUoGJo2

## Sensor drift: what to do at 3am

If the GrowLoop controller starts reporting humidity swings that don't match the backup probes in the Fernwick greenhouse, it's almost always sensor drift, not an actual climate event. Don't panic and don't touch the vents manually. First, restart the calibration daemon and give it ten minutes to re-baseline. If readings still disagree by more than 5%, flip the controller into safe mode. The safe-mode thresholds it will use are these.

config for yahap-bajof:
[istix]
host = istix.qorvelsys.internal
user = istix_svc
database = istix_prod